Food Retail — Emissions (CO2eq) from N2O in Anguilla
Anguilla: Food Retail — Emissions (CO2eq) from N2O was 0.0151 kt in 2023. ▲ Rising
Food Retail — Emissions (CO2eq) from N2O in Anguilla, 1990–2023
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in kt.
Analysis
Anguilla recorded 0.0151 kt for food retail — emissions (co2eq) from n2o in 2023.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 7.9% on the previous year and down 3.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, food retail — emissions (co2eq) from n2o in Anguilla peaked at 0.0188 kt in 2016 and was at its lowest, 0.004 kt, in 1995.
Anguilla ranks 169th of 190 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 34 years of available data.

About this data
The FAOSTAT domain on Emissions Totals summarizes the gre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ions disseminated in the FAOSTAT Climate Change domains of emissions from agrifood systems. Data are computed following the Tier 1 methods of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C) Guidelines for National greenhouse gas (GHG) Inventories (IPCC, 1996; 1997; 2000; 2002; 2006; 2014). Emissions from other economic sectors as defined by the IPCC are also disseminated in the domain for completeness.
